Hi all!, many new features are appearing in Blender so fast that it’s almost impossible to learn it all at once, but you have to start somewhere.. the most interesting feature to me was the brand new particle system, it’s huge!, thats why I decided to use my free time in trying to get ride of those buttons in all the new 5 (yes, five!) panels, I missed a few.. well, a lot.

Daniel, AKA Dan!, is the result of this experiment trying to learn new stuff, well.. you can’t actually see the new particles in Dan, it is mostly about the shading and the way you work with them, at first I was thinking in adding hair to the whole character, but finally it just doesn’t looked quite good.. so I decided to just put some hair in the center of the body.. and maybe in the legs and neck.

For the stats junkies, 100.000 particles were used in Dan (many emitters, parents/childs) and each of this renders took less than 2 minutes in a Sempron 3400 single core, while Fraka -less than a year ago with almost the same number of particles (old system) tooks almost 4 min to render in an Athlon 3800 dual core, not even want to talk about memory usage.. So, particles have been optimized so much lately, now the shadowbuffers and the particle strands are threadeables! so you can separate the work load in all your cores, and this means *lot* of improvement in rendering speed.
Particle rendering is So fast now that you can’t stop adding particles!, like in this ugly render:

It’s useless to say that the character has no image textures at all (except for the eyes), just hair and one material for the whole character, painted with VertexPaint for trying color schemes more easily.
